Magnesium L-Threonate is a unique form of magnesium, known for its potential cognitive and physiological benefits. It is derived from the combination of magnesium and L-threonic acid. Recent studies have shown that it can effectively elevate magnesium levels in the brain. This can lead to enhanced memory function and improved overall cognitive health. A study published in the Journal of Neuroscience reported significant increases in synaptic function after administration of Magnesium L-Threonate.
Research indicates that magnesium plays a critical role in various bodily functions. Approximately 60% of the body's magnesium is stored in the bones, and it is essential for over 300 enzymatic processes. However, many people are magnesium deficient. The World Health Organization reports that approximately 80% of adults do not meet the daily recommended intake of magnesium. This deficiency may contribute to cognitive decline, emphasizing the importance of supplements like Magnesium L-Threonate for brain health.

Magnesium L-Threonate has gained attention for its potential benefits in enhancing cognitive function and memory. Research suggests that it effectively increases magnesium levels in the brain. Studies have shown that magnesium plays a critical role in synaptic plasticity, which is essential for learning and memory. One notable study published in the journal "Neuron" found an impressive improvement in cognitive function after supplementing with Magnesium L-Threonate.
Two human studies revealed that magnesium supplementation may enhance working memory. Participants reported noticeable improvements in memory tasks. Furthermore, a recent review in "Frontiers in Neuroscience" highlights magnesium's influence on neuroprotective properties. It suggests that increased magnesium may help mitigate age-related cognitive decline.
